        Well I’ve been a bit optimist…

        In fact there’s a problem with MotionDetector and a TV display, after a while the tv goes in deep sleep mode and does not wake up.

        If I turn the energy saving off on the tv, it still stays on with a “no signal” message.

        I’m trying some things with CEC at the moment wich can turn on a tv monitor, I’ll let you know …
